A mermaid swimsuit typically features elements that mimic the appearance of a mermaid's tail and upper body. The most distinctive characteristic is often a scale-like pattern that adorns the fabric, creating an illusion of iridescent fish scales. These patterns can range from subtle, monochromatic designs to bold, multi-colored arrangements that catch the light and shimmer like the surface of the ocean.
The evolution of the mermaid swimsuit has been nothing short of remarkable. From its early iterations as simple, scale-printed one-pieces, the design has expanded to include a wide variety of styles. Today, you can find mermaid swimsuits in the form of bikinis, tankinis, monokinis, and even elaborate costume-like pieces that extend below the knees to create a more realistic tail effect.
One of the most popular styles of mermaid swimsuits is the classic one-piece. These suits often feature a sweetheart neckline or halter top, reminiscent of the seashell bras worn by mermaids in popular depictions. The body of the suit is typically adorned with a scale pattern that becomes more pronounced towards the bottom, creating a seamless transition from human to fish-like appearance.
For those who prefer a two-piece look, mermaid bikinis offer a playful and versatile option. The tops often incorporate shell-shaped cups or scale patterns, while the bottoms feature high-waisted designs with a scale print that extends down the thighs. Some designs even include additional fabric or mesh that can be wrapped around the legs to create a tail-like effect when lounging on the beach.

The materials used in crafting mermaid swimsuits have also evolved to enhance both the visual appeal and functionality of these garments. Many designers opt for high-quality, quick-drying fabrics that offer UV protection and chlorine resistance. These technical features ensure that the swimsuit not only looks magical but also performs well in various aquatic environments.
Some mermaid swimsuits incorporate holographic or color-changing fabrics that shift hues as the wearer moves or when viewed from different angles. This effect mimics the iridescent quality of fish scales and adds an extra layer of enchantment to the overall design. Other suits may feature sequins or metallic threads woven into the fabric to create a sparkling, underwater-like shimmer.

The popularity of mermaid swimsuits has given rise to a broader fashion trend known as "mermaidcore." This aesthetic encompasses not only swimwear but also clothing, accessories, and beauty products inspired by the mystical world of mermaids. From sequined dresses that mimic fish scales to seashell-shaped purses and ocean-hued makeup palettes, mermaidcore has made a splash in the fashion industry.

The environmental impact of fashion has become an increasingly important consideration, and the mermaid swimsuit trend is no exception. Many eco-conscious designers are creating sustainable mermaid swimsuits using recycled materials, such as plastic recovered from the ocean. This approach not only produces beautiful swimwear but also raises awareness about marine conservation and the importance of protecting our oceans – the real-life home of the creatures that inspire these magical designs.
